A method of determining the ionospheric delay with the two-way satellite dual-frequency (C band) observation is introduced, and the results from the observations for different longitudes and latitudes are analysed and compared to each other. The two-way satellite dual-frequency (C band) observation is characterized by high accuracy and fast sampling and can detect the slight change in the total electron content of the ionosphere.
